This Ends at Prom is a weekly podcast analyzing the staying power of womanhood featured in coming-of-age and teen girl movies from the queer, feminist cisgender and transgender perspectives of wives BJ Colangelo and Harmony Colangelo.

Coming of age isn't always about prom dresses and virginity pacts, sometimes it's a lot more... raw. This week The Wives Colangelo are joined by the brilliant Vanessa Guerrero to discuss Julia Ducournau's coming-of-rage masterpiece, RAW. Together they discuss why cannibalism stories are so prominent in teen horror, what it feels like to put on femininity as a costume, and why it's so satisfying to watch someone just rip something apart with their teeth.
